China presents the global second largest Technology fueled by huge developmental capitals and superb researches.... Importantly, the government observes the significance of investing in Technology developments (OECD, 2008).... In fact, the government has prioritized Technology as critical developmental strategy, hence, invests heavily in the sector.... For instance, in 2008, the Chinese government channeled over $140 billion in Technology-based projects (Gao, 2009)....

The logistic performance of the countries was measured on six components out of which the quality of infrastructure related to trade and transport such as ports, roads, railroads and communication Technology topped the list.... Mobile communications Technology has widely bridged the digital divide between least developed and developed countries and the mobile communication penetration rate at the end of 2010 was noted to be 29% (ITU News, 2011).... This shows that mobile communication Technology has been able to overcome the infrastructure barrier to some extent unlike the landline (fixed) phones which showed a penetration rate of 1%....
